Budgeting for a Labrador Retriever

One of the first financial aspects to consider is setting a budget for your Labrador Retriever’s needs. This will help you plan and allocate funds for expenses such as food, grooming, training, medical care, and other supplies. Here are some key points to consider when budgeting for a Labrador Retriever:

Image

– Food: Labrador Retrievers are known for their hearty appetites, so you should budget for high-quality dog food that meets their nutritional needs. Consider the cost of both dry and wet food options, and factor in any dietary restrictions or health conditions.

– Grooming: Labrador Retrievers have short, dense coats that require regular grooming to keep them healthy and looking their best. Budget for grooming supplies such as brushes, shampoos, and nail clippers, as well as professional grooming sessions if necessary.

– Veterinary Care: Regular veterinary check-ups, vaccinations, and preventive care are essential for maintaining your Labrador’s health. Budget for annual check-ups, vaccinations, flea and tick prevention, heartworm medication, and any unforeseen medical expenses that may arise.

– Training and Socialization: Labrador Retrievers are intelligent and energetic dogs that benefit from proper training and socialization. Consider the cost of training classes, obedience courses, and toys or tools that can assist in their development.

– Supplies: Labrador Retrievers require various supplies such as beds, crates, leashes, collars, toys, and bowls. Budget for these items and plan for regular replacements as needed.

Emergency Funds and Pet Insurance

In addition to the regular expenses, it is important to have emergency funds set aside for any unexpected medical or other pet-related expenses that may arise. It is also advisable to consider pet insurance, which can help cover the cost of veterinary care in case of accidents or illnesses. Pet insurance can provide peace of mind and help alleviate the financial burden of unexpected expenses.

Financial Preparations Before Bringing a Labrador Home

Before bringing a Labrador Retriever into your home, it is important to anticipate the financial responsibilities involved. Here are some key steps to take before bringing your furry friend home:

– Research and Estimate Costs: Research the average costs of owning a Labrador Retriever and estimate the monthly and yearly expenses. This will give you a better idea of what to expect and help you plan accordingly.

– Create a Separate Pet Budget: Consider creating a separate budget or tracking system specifically for your Labrador’s expenses. This will help you keep track of your spending and ensure that you stay within your allocated budget.

– Consider Pet Care Alternatives: If you and your partner work long hours or have frequent travel commitments, it may be necessary to budget for alternative pet care options such as dog walkers, doggy daycare, or pet sitters. These additional expenses should be factored into your budget.

– Research Local Veterinarians and Pet Services: Before bringing a Labrador home, research local veterinarians, pet stores, and other pet services to get an idea of their costs. It is important to find veterinarians and service providers that offer quality care at an affordable price.

1. How much does it cost to own a Labrador Retriever?
– The cost of owning a Labrador Retriever can vary depending on various factors such as food, grooming, veterinary care, training, and supplies.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,000 per year.

2. Is pet insurance a good idea for Labrador Retrievers?
– Pet insurance can be a good idea for Labrador Retrievers, as they are prone to certain health conditions such as hip dysplasia and obesity. Having pet insurance can help cover the cost of veterinary care in case of accidents or illnesses.
